Authorities are destroying 5,000 birds in Hungary – here is why
Avian influenza has been detected at a farm in southeast Hungary, food safety authority Nebih said on its website.
The virus subtype H5N1 was detected at a turkey farm in Békés County. The close to 5,000 birds are being destroyed and restrictions have been introduced. Nébih detected bird flu at several other farms in other counties in November.
